Colegio ArceEnglish DepartmentSyllabus
COURSE TITLE: ENGLISH 1CONTACT HOURS: 3 hours per weekREQUIREMENTS : None
COURSE DESCRITPTION : This course is designed for students in the 1 level of high school to develop the communicative competence of the second language by developing linguistic communnicative skills ׃ oral and written production and listening and reading comprehension
GENERAL OBJECTIVES : Students will be engaged in various listening, speaking, writing and reading activities in class, and will be guided to :
Communicate in really situations. Develop listening and speaking skills and improve intonation, pronunciation, articulation,
stress, pitch, and volume. Develop vocabulary, idiomatic expressions, Increase self-confidence, fluency and accuracy when speaking in English.
SPECIFIC OBJECTIVES : By the end of this course, the students will :
Gain more confidence in speaking the English language.They will :
Become more aware of their own aprehension.when speaking English. Analyze about their aprehension. Practice fear reduction techniques.
Students will become more aware of the listenign skills by :
Listening and practicing of individual words, especially vocabulary building exercises.
Students will become aware of library- media resources, they will:
Share ideas with other through small groups and whole class discussions. Create oral presentations base on articles read by following appropriate steps.
EVALUATION CRITERIA :
Student`s proficiency in the class will be measured by the following :
1. Evaluations : reports.Written : quizzes, tests, summaries. 50 percent
